A new study by researchers at the Harvard school of public health found that drinking three to five cups of coffee is associated with a 15 percent decreased mortality rate. Decaf coffee conferred similar benefits, so even if caffeine hops you up like a toddler on Halloween, you can still become immortal like me.

This isn't the first study to suggest coffee's benefits. Previous studies have linked coffee consumption to decreased risks of strokes and type 2 diabetes. Hallelujah, praise the lord, coffee is a goddamn health food!
